Relaxation exercises
Many studies back that progressive muscle relaxation can help calm the body and promote sleep. By systematically tensing and relaxing your body muscles, slowly from head to toe, right before going to sleep, you may fall asleep without any difficulty. Research indicates that by calming your muscles, you may reduce stress and anxiety, which are among the most common causes of insomnia. You can also try breathing exercises or meditation to cope with insomnia along with using CBD sleep supplements.

Physical activity
Performing physical exercise for 30-40 mins at least thrice a week helps improve your sleep quality. When you exercise, your muscles get tired and go through minor wear & tear. To repair and restore them, the body needs rest, making you sleep faster than usual. Plus, studies suggest that exercise increases the body temperature, and a drop in the temperature post-exercise may promote sleep.
